相关文章
暑期实习总结(焊点数据管理软件开发):Python操作MySQL数据库、Django搭建前端网页、以及Excel中数据与MySQL数据库的互转
暑期实习总结(焊点数据管理软件开发):Python操作MySQL数据库、Django搭建前端网页、以及Excel中数据与MySQL数据库的互转
这一周是我在企业实习的最后一周,在企业做的项目已基本完成。这篇博客的目的也是总结一些项目中的一些小问题&…
建站知识
2024/11/21 1:35:29
21 - form表单验证 和 csrf跨站请求伪造
一. Form 表单验证 (1). 官网:
https://wtforms.readthedocs.io/en/2.3.x/ (2). 安装第三方库
pip install Flask-WTF(3). form类型和校验
# Field类型:StringField # 字符串PasswordField # 密码IntegerField # 整形DecimalField # 浮点,可以指定小数点位数FloatFi…
建站知识
2024/11/21 1:25:49
3款最强的AI视频生成器,支持文生视频、图生视频
当我们深入人工智能世界及其对视频创作的变革性影响时,发现人工智能视频生成器的强大功能。人工智能视频生成器正在彻底改变我们创建内容的方式,让我们比以往更轻松地以最少的努力制作高质量的视频。无论您是内容创作者、营销人员,还是只是一…
建站知识
2024/11/21 1:35:24
ROS功能包目录下CMakeLists.txt
1. add_execuble
CMake基础教程(24)add_executable生成目标可执行文件 CMake中add_executable的使用
CMake中的add_executable命令用于使用指定的源文件向项目(project)添加可执行文件,其格式如下:
add_executable(<name>…
建站知识
2024/11/21 1:35:21
vue 路由动态加载
在 Vue.js 中,可以使用 webpack 的动态导入语法来实现路由动态加载。下面是一个简单的示例:
const Home () > import(/* webpackChunkName: "home" */ ./views/Home.vue);
const About () > import(/* webpackChunkName: "about…
建站知识
2024/11/21 1:35:20
探讨C#、C++和Java这三门语言在嵌入式的地位
我理解对于初入嵌入式领域的担忧。你是想选择一款通用性最广的语言专心学习,但是不知如何选择,视频后方提供了免费的嵌入式学习资源,内容涵盖入门到进阶,需要的到后方免费获取。因为我也曾是一名计算机专业毕业生。通过一段时间的…
建站知识
2024/11/21 1:35:14
iOS如何获取设备型号的最新方法总结
每一种 iOS 设备型号都有对应的一个或多个硬件编码/标识符,称为 device model 或者叫 machine name
通常的做法是,先获取设备的 device model 值,再手动映射为具体的设备型号(或者直接把 device model 值传给后端,让后…
建站知识
2024/11/21 1:35:09
uni-app开发小程序,radio单选按钮,点击可以选中,再次点击可以取消
一、实现效果: 二、代码实现: 不适用官方的change方法,自己定义点击方法。 动态判断定义的值是否等于遍历的值进行回显,如果和上一次点击的值一样,就把定义的值改为null <template><view><radio-group&…
建站知识
2024/11/21 1:35:05